Understanding the Cabin Air Filter in Your Honda
A cabin air filter is a pleated, multi-layered filter typically made from paper-based or synthetic fibrous material. It is installed in the HVAC system of most modern Honda vehicles, usually located behind the glove compartment, under the dashboard, or under the hood near the windshield cowl. Its primary function is to clean the outside air entering the passenger compartment through the climate control system. As air is drawn in, the filter traps and holds various particulate contaminants before they circulate inside the car. This is a separate component from the engine air filter, which cleans air entering the engine for combustion. The cabin filter deals exclusively with the air you and your passengers breathe.
Key Functions and Benefits for Honda Drivers
The cabin air filter performs several vital roles. First, it improves in-vehicle air quality by capturing airborne particles. These particles include dust, dirt, pollen, spores, and soot. For individuals with allergies, asthma, or other respiratory sensitivities, a clean filter can significantly reduce symptom triggers during travel. Second, it protects the interior HVAC components. By preventing debris from entering, it keeps the blower motor, evaporator core, and ductwork cleaner. This helps maintain proper airflow and heating/cooling capacity. A clogged filter forces the blower motor to work harder, which can diminish its performance and lifespan. Third, it reduces common odors. Over time, organic material like leaves or pollen trapped in a dirty filter can foster mold or mildew growth, leading to a musty smell when the fan is activated. A fresh filter prevents this buildup at the source.
Signs Your Honda's Cabin Air Filter Needs Replacement
Recognizing the symptoms of a dirty or clogged filter allows for proactive replacement. The most common indicator is noticeably reduced airflow from the dashboard vents, even when the fan is set to a high speed. You may find you need to set the fan higher to achieve the same level of ventilation. Another clear sign is persistent unpleasant odors emanating from the vents, often described as dusty, moldy, or sour, particularly when the air conditioning or heat is first turned on. Increased window fogging can also point to a restricted filter, as proper airflow across the evaporator core is needed for effective defogging. For allergy sufferers, an uptick in sneezing or congestion while in the car may suggest the filter is saturated and no longer capturing allergens effectively. Honda's official maintenance minder system, found in most models from the mid-2000s onward, includes a code for cabin air filter inspection, but it does not always trigger a specific replacement alert, making manual checks important.
Locating the Cabin Air Filter in Various Honda Models
The filter's location varies by Honda model and model year, but the most common placement is behind the glove box. In models like the Honda Civic, Accord, and CR-V from the last two decades, accessing it typically involves gently removing the glove box by depressing stoppers or removing pins, allowing it to swing down and reveal the filter housing. In some older models or certain trims, the filter may be located under the dashboard on the passenger side or in the engine compartment near the base of the windshield, behind a plastic panel. It is crucial to consult your owner's manual for the exact location and access procedure for your specific vehicle. The manual provides the authorized steps and any warnings. If you do not have the physical manual, most Honda owners' websites or reputable automotive information portals host digital copies searchable by your Vehicle Identification Number (VIN) or model details.
Step-by-Step Guide to Replacing a Honda Cabin Air Filter
Replacing the filter is generally a straightforward do-it-yourself task requiring minimal tools. Most jobs only need a new, correct filter and possibly a screwdriver or trim tool. Always ensure the vehicle is parked on a level surface with the ignition off. Begin by locating the filter housing as per your manual. For the common behind-the-glove-box location, empty the glove compartment. Look for stops or straps on the sides. You may need to squeeze the sides of the glove box inward to allow it to drop down past its stops, or remove a few screws or pins. Once the glove box is lowered or removed, you will see a rectangular or square plastic cover, usually secured with clips or small screws. Open this cover by releasing the clips or removing the fasteners. Carefully note the direction of the airflow arrows printed on the edge of the old filter. Gently pull the old filter straight out. Inspect the housing for any loose debris and use a vacuum cleaner hose to clean it if possible. Take the new filter and ensure it is the exact match for your Honda model. Align it so the airflow arrows point in the same direction as the old one—typically toward the interior or as marked on the housing. Slide the new filter in completely. Close and secure the cover. Reinstall the glove box by reversing the removal process. Finally, turn on the ignition and run the fan at various speeds to ensure proper operation and check for new noises.
Selecting the Correct Replacement Filter for Your Honda
Using the right filter is essential for proper fit and function. Cabin air filters are not universal. They vary by size, shape, and filtration technology. The three main types are particulate filters, activated carbon filters, and combination filters. A standard particulate filter captures solid particles like dust and pollen. An activated carbon filter adds a layer of charcoal-impregnated material that absorbs gases and odors, such as from traffic exhaust. Combination filters offer both particulate filtration and odor reduction. For Honda vehicles, the manufacturer offers genuine Honda replacement parts, but many aftermarket brands like FRAM, Bosch, or EPAuto produce high-quality equivalents. To find the correct part, use your vehicle's year, make, model, and trim level. Auto parts store websites or filter retailer sites have robust vehicle lookup tools. You can also find the part number on the edge of the old filter or in your owner's manual. When in doubt, consult with a Honda dealership parts department. For most drivers in urban or high-allergen areas, a combination carbon filter provides the best overall air cleaning.
Recommended Replacement Intervals and Factors Influencing Them
Honda's general recommendation in many owner's manuals is to inspect the cabin air filter every 15,000 to 30,000 miles or once per year, whichever comes first, and replace it as needed. However, this interval is highly dependent on driving conditions. Vehicles operated in densely polluted urban areas, regions with high pollen counts, or on consistently dusty, gravel, or construction-heavy roads will require more frequent changes, perhaps every 10,000 to 15,000 miles. Conversely, a car primarily driven on clean highways in a mild climate might safely go 25,000 miles or more. A simple visual inspection is the best guide. During a replacement, hold the old filter up to a bright light. If light barely passes through and the pleats are packed with debris, it is time for a change. For optimal air quality and system protection, erring on the side of more frequent replacement, such as annually, is a low-cost practice with tangible benefits.
Common Mistakes to Avoid During DIY Replacement
Several common errors can compromise the job. First, forcing the filter into the housing. If it does not slide in smoothly, do not bend or cram it. Verify you have the correct part and that it is oriented properly. Forcing it can damage the filter seal or the housing clips. Second, installing the filter backwards. The airflow arrows must point in the correct direction. A backwards filter can be less effective and may cause unusual whistling noises from restricted airflow. Third, neglecting to clean the housing. Before inserting the new filter, take a moment to remove any leaves, twigs, or dust from the housing compartment with a vacuum or cloth. This prevents immediate re-contamination. Fourth, not fully securing the access panel. Ensure all clips are engaged or screws are tightened to prevent rattles and ensure all air is routed through the filter. Finally, using a low-quality or ill-fitting filter. Substandard filters may use inferior materials that tear, shed fibers, or collapse, potentially allowing debris into the blower motor.
Professional Replacement Versus Do-It-Yourself
Replacing a cabin air filter is one of the simplest and most cost-effective maintenance items to perform yourself. The part typically costs between 15 and 50, and the job takes 10 to 20 minutes with no specialized skills. Doing it yourself saves on labor charges, which at a dealership or repair shop can double the total cost, and gives you immediate control over the quality of the part used. However, there are instances where professional service is advisable. If you are uncomfortable with the process after reviewing the steps, or if accessing the filter in your specific Honda model requires complex dashboard disassembly, having a technician perform the service during a routine oil change is reasonable. Authorized Honda service centers will use genuine parts and can document the service in your vehicle's history. For most common Honda models, however, the ease and savings of a DIY replacement are significant.
Impact of a Clean Filter on HVAC System Longevity and Health
A clean cabin air filter contributes directly to the longevity and efficiency of the entire HVAC system. When the filter is clean, air moves through it with minimal restriction. This allows the blower motor to operate at its designed efficiency, reducing electrical load and wear. It also ensures proper airflow across the evaporator core, which is essential for effective dehumidification and cooling. A clogged filter reduces this airflow, which can cause the evaporator to become too cold and potentially freeze over in humid conditions, leading to a complete loss of cooling until it thaws. Furthermore, reduced airflow can strain the blower motor resistor, a common failure point. By maintaining a clean filter, you help prevent these issues, promoting more consistent climate control performance and avoiding repairs that are far more expensive than a filter.
Specific Considerations for Popular Honda Models
While the general principles apply, some Honda models have minor nuances. For recent Honda Civic models, the filter is almost universally behind the glove box with a simple clip-down access panel. In Honda Accord sedans, the process is similarly straightforward, though some model years may have a slightly different glove box retention method. For Honda CR-V and Pilot SUVs, the location is also typically behind the glove box, but the housing might be oriented vertically. The Honda Odyssey minivan often has a filter accessed from under the hood near the windshield on the passenger side, requiring removal of a plastic cowl cover. For the Honda HR-V, it is usually behind the glove box. Always double-check the specific procedure for your model year, as manufacturers can make minor changes. Online video tutorials for your exact vehicle can be invaluable visual guides to complement your owner's manual.
Environmental and Disposal Considerations
Used cabin air filters contain captured pollutants and should be disposed of properly to prevent releasing these particles back into the air. Do not shake or tap the old filter vigorously outdoors, as this can disperse allergens. The most common disposal method is to place the entire used filter into a plastic bag, seal it, and put it in your regular household trash. Some municipalities may have specific guidelines. While cabin filters themselves are not typically recyclable due to the mixed materials and contaminants, the plastic packaging of the new filter often is. Check local recycling rules for plastic packaging. There is a growing market for reusable, washable cabin filters, but these are not commonly offered or recommended for most Honda applications by the manufacturer, and their long-term filtration efficiency compared to new disposable filters can vary.

Addressing Frequently Asked Questions
Many Honda owners have similar questions about this component. A frequent query is whether a dirty cabin filter affects fuel economy. The answer is no, not directly. The cabin air filter is part of the passenger compartment climate system, not the engine's air intake. It does not impact engine performance or fuel efficiency. Another common question is about cleaning versus replacing. Cabin air filters are designed as disposable items. Attempting to clean one with compressed air or vacuuming is ineffective, as it does not restore the filter media's full capacity and can damage the fine pleats. Replacement is the only reliable method. Owners also ask if they can run the vehicle without a filter temporarily. This is not advised. Doing so allows unfiltered air and debris directly into the HVAC system, exposing the blower motor and evaporator core to immediate contamination and increasing the risk of mold growth on the evaporator from wet organic material.
